John M. Napier, Of Counsel at Hanger Law, brings extensive experience representing developers, builders, and businesses in residential and commercial real estate matters. His practice focuses on land use, zoning issues, and complex transactions, where he is known for crafting practical solutions tailored to the needs of both large-scale developers and startup ventures.
Mr. Napier earned his Juris Doctor from Pepperdine University School of Law and further completed a Master of Dispute Resolution at Pepperdine, equipping him with strong negotiation and mediation skills. He also holds a Bachelor of Arts from the College of William & Mary. He is admitted to practice law in Virginia, California, and before the United States Supreme Court, enabling him to serve a diverse range of clients across various jurisdictions.
In his career, Mr. Napier has guided clients through title issues, contract disputes, and multi-million-dollar zoning and development matters. His solutions-based approach ensures efficient resolution of legal challenges while supporting long-term business goals. He has worked alongside some of the largest real estate developers and investors in Coastal Virginia, while also advising new ventures and entrepreneurs navigating complex business landscapes.
Recognized for his professionalism, John M. Napier has received honors such as Martindale-Hubbell’s Client Champion Award and Avvo’s Top Attorney designation. He also serves as a board member for Tidewater Real Estate Investors, reflecting his ongoing commitment to advancing the real estate community.
